Easy, Stress-Free Arrival and Check-In

Florence:Accademia Gallery Entry with Host & Interactive App - Easy, Stress-Free Arrival and Check-In

One of the biggest advantages of this tour is the hosted check-in. Arriving at the designated meeting point outside Via Ricasoli 43, you’ll find your local host holding a sign marked EU Tours. The friendly face eases any travel stress, especially in a busy city like Florence, where line-waiting can be a real time sink. The host not only checks you in but also ensures you’re set up with the interactive app, so you’re ready to explore once inside.

Reviewers appreciate the organized process, with Daniel noting, “Everything was well organized, and they help you with everything.” The friendly assistance extends to explaining how to use the app, so even if you’re not tech-savvy, you’ll quickly get comfortable.

Is the entry to the Accademia Gallery included in this tour?
Yes, your ticket grants reserved, timed-entry access to the gallery, including official museum fees.

Do I need to pay anything extra once inside?
No, all entry fees are included in the $40 price. The ticket covers your access and use of the interactive app.

How does the check-in process work?
A friendly local host will meet you outside Via Ricasoli 43 with a sign of EU Tours, help you check in, and set you up with the app.

Can I explore the gallery at my own pace?
Absolutely. The app provides audio commentary and info that you can listen to or skip as you prefer.

Is this tour suitable for families or children?
While it’s primarily designed for individual exploration, children comfortable with walking and stairs will enjoy the artworks and views.

What are the physical requirements?
You should be prepared for some stairs, especially if you decide to climb nearby attractions like the Bell Tower, as noted in reviews.

How long does the visit typically take?
While not specified, many visitors spend around 1-2 hours exploring the gallery and using the app.

Are guided tours available as part of this package?
No, this is a self-guided experience, but the app serves as your personal guide.

Can I cancel or reschedule?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, providing flexibility if your plans change.

What should I bring?
Headphones are recommended to fully enjoy the app’s audio stories.
